JD as below: What youll be doing Managing data into and out of our data warehouse and reporting platforms to ensure accuracy and efficiency. Definition and quality of KPIs that support effective contact centre operations. Delivering data development roadmaps aligned to either our Consumer or Enterprise business strategies. Empowering end users with access to reliable, well-governed … data sets in a secure environment. Troubleshooting complex data issues across multiple source systems and ensuring smooth data operations. Leading strategic, cross-functional projects to deliver impactful, data-driven solutions, while documenting processes for team-wide support. What skills youll need Certified Google Cloud (GCP) Data Engineer with strong expertise in dataacquisition, modelling, ETL, and data warehousing. Proficient in Terraform, YAML, and GitLab for environment management. Skilled in MS SQL, GCP SQL, and Oracle DB design, with a focus on data quality and governance. Strong understanding of contact centre metrics and systems (e.g. WFM, IVR, Call Routing). Proven ability to lead technical teams and deliver end-to-end More ❯
OT resource. Planning and overseeing maintenance of OT systems software and hardware installed at solar PV and battery energy storage plants throughout the UK Supporting operational staff with monitoring, dataacquisition, security, and CCTV systems issue resolutions Adherence to the BSR Groups Quality Management System and processes What experience you will have: Essential: Management of a technical team … and learning Strong communicator with patience and perseverance, able to troubleshoot and problem-solve with remote staff or equipment Preferred: Knowledge and experience of PV specific and general industrial dataacquisition systems Linux system administration experience, focussed on Debian or derivatives, Ansible for centralised management, iptables/NFT firewalls. Experience of the following network equipment; Fortinet firewalls and More ❯
with a global presence, seeking a Senior Software Engineer to join their innovative platform engineering team. This is an exceptional opportunity to work on cutting-edge systems that process data at scale, powering decision-making in fast-moving global markets. Our client is a diversified principal trading firm operating across multiple asset classes, financial instruments, and emerging sectors. Key … platform-level software engineering Strong computer science fundamentals (degree or equivalent experience) Proven expertise in Java, Python, or other modern programming languages Experience working with large-scale, high-volume data systems Strong problem-solving and analytical skills Comfortable collaborating with distributed, global teams The Role As part of a highly skilled engineering team, you will: Build tools to enable … opportunities and enhance trading operations Partner closely with analysts, quants, and traders to understand their needs and deliver intuitive, self-service solutions Design and develop systems for large-scale dataacquisition, processing, storage, and visualisation Contribute to a platform that consolidates technologies and data to accelerate research and trading strategies Continuously refine and extend global platform capabilities More ❯
control frameworks. Implementation of autonomy algorithms, including SLAM, path planning, adaptive control, and real-time obstacle avoidance, with focus on GNSS denied localisation. Development of real-time systems for dataacquisition, onboard processing, and underwater communication (acoustic, RF, optical). Testing and validation, including hardware-in-the-loop simulations and live sea trials, ensuring robust performance in challenging More ❯